The cost of garage floor raising in Bellevue, WA can vary significantly depending on a variety of factors. This process is essential for homeowners looking to level their garage floors, fix drainage issues, or repair damage caused by settling. Understanding the costs involved can help you budget effectively and ensure you get the best value for your investment.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Size of the Garage: Larger garages require more materials and labor, which increases the overall cost.
  • Extent of Damage: More severe damage may necessitate additional work and materials, raising the cost.
  • Type of Material: Different materials, such as concrete or polyurethane foam, have varying costs.
  • Labor Rates: Labor costs can vary based on the expertise and rates of local contractors.
  • Accessibility: Difficult-to-access areas may require specialized equipment, which can add to the cost.
  •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the overall expense.
  • Additional Repairs: Any additional repairs needed, such as fixing cracks or drainage issues, will increase the cost.

Average Costs for Common Tasks

Task Average Cost in Bellevue, WA
Garage Floor Raising (per sq ft) $5 - $10
Polyurethane Foam Injection $2,000 - $3,500
Concrete Slab Replacement $3,000 - $5,000
Crack Repair $500 - $1,000
Drainage Improvement $1,000 - $2,500
Permits and Inspections $100 - $300

Understanding these factors and average costs can help you plan your garage floor raising project in Bellevue, WA more effectively.
